6000 Watt Generator
Inspection, Cleaning, and Maintenance
WARNING! ALWAYS MAKE SURE THE GENERATOR POWER SWITCH IS IN ITS
“STOP" POSITION. DISCONNECT THE SPARK PLUG WIRE FROM THE ENGINE AND
ALLOW SUFFICIENT TIME FOR THE ENGINE AND GENERATOR TO COMPLETELY
COOL BEFORE PERFORMING ANY INSPECTIONS, MAINTENANCE, OR CLEANING.
Before each use, inspect the generator. Check for:
- Loose screws
- Misaligned or binding moving parts
- Cracked or broken parts
- Damaged electrical wiring, or
- Any other condition that may affect safe operation.
If an engine problem occurs, have it checked by a qualified service technician before further use.
Do not use damaged equipment.
Before each use, make sure the engine's oil and gas levels are adequate. If necessary, fill the
crankcase until the oil level is even with the oil fill hole or at the upper level on the oil level cap.
Also fill the gas tank with gas until the fuel gauge shows full.
Before each use, remove all debris with a soft brush, rag, or vacuum.
Lubricate all moving parts using premium quality and lightweight machine oil.
Every 20 hours of use, drain old engine oil and
replace with approximately ¾ quart of high quality
SAE 10W-30 grade engine oil. DO NOT
OVERFILL OIL.
Every 300 hours of use, have a qualified and
certified technician perform thorough maintenance
on the generator and engine.
For long term storage, either drain fuel into a
suitable container or add a fuel
preservative/stabilizer (not included) to prevent
fuel breakdown.
